Ahead of the election on the 30th of May 2026, the Labour Party has begun to unveil its proposals forming part of this year’s electoral campaign.

The Labour Party has proposed a significant increase in the birth bonus as part of its electoral programme, aimed at providing stronger financial support to families.

Currently, parents receive €1,000 for a first child, €1,500 for a second, and €2,000 for a third or subsequent child.

Under the new proposal, this would be replaced by a flat payment of €5,000 for every child, regardless of birth order.

The scheme would also introduce earlier financial assistance, with an initial €3,000 payment issued during the seventh month of pregnancy. The remaining balance would then be paid following the child’s birth.

The party said the measure is designed to better support families as they prepare for the arrival of a child, easing financial pressures during pregnancy and immediately after birth.
